Pork Chop (Bone-In, Grilled)
349 calories per 1 medium pork chop (151g)
Try in our Calorie CalculatorNutrition Facts
Per 100g
| Calories | 231 kcal |
| Protein | 25.7g |
| Carbohydrates | 0g |
| Fat | 13.5g |
| Fiber | 0g |
| Sugar | 0g |
| Sodium | 62mg |
Per serving (1 medium pork chop (151g))
| Calories | 349 kcal |
| Protein | 38.8g |
| Carbohydrates | 0.0g |
| Fat | 20.4g |
Macronutrient Ratio
Protein 46%Carbs 0%Fat 54%
About Pork Chop (Bone-In, Grilled)
Pork chops are a weeknight dinner staple that cook quickly and take well to brines, rubs, and marinades. Modern pork is leaner than decades past, so avoiding overcooking is key to keeping the meat juicy and tender.
